Carnedd y Filiast (821m)


The weather was a bit unsure of itself today with bright, sunny weather down at the coast but a bit overcast and windy in the mountains. Me and the boys decided to venture up Carnedd y Filiast as they had never been up this peak before but if the wind was too strong we would only go as far as y Fronllwyd (the NW shoulder) @ 721m. As it happened, the wind was OK and quite warm and we found a lot of shelter on the north side and we were rewarded with some fantastic views into the mountains as well as down to the coast.
